158.6459 Intervention strategies for accelerated learning -- Individualized learning
plan -- Retake of college admissions examination.

A high school student whose scores on the high school readiness examination
administered in grade eight (8), on the college readiness examination administered
in grade ten (10), or on the WorkKeys indicate that additional assistance or
advanced work is required in English, reading, or mathematics shall have
intervention strategies for accelerated learning incorporated into his or her learning
plan.
A high school student whose score on the college admissions examination under
KRS 158.6453(11)(a)3. in English, reading, or mathematics is below the
systemwide standard established by the Council on Postsecondary Education for
entry into a credit-bearing course at a public postsecondary institution without
placement in a remedial course or an entry-level course with supplementary
academic support shall be provided the opportunity to participate in accelerated
learning designed to address his or her identified academic deficiencies prior to high
school graduation.
A high school, in collaboration with its school district, shall develop and implement
accelerated learning that:
(a) Allows a student's learning plan to be individualized to meet the student's
academic needs based on an assessment of test results and consultation among
parents, teachers, and the student; and
(b) May include changes in a student's class schedule.
The Kentucky Department of Education, the Council on Postsecondary Education,
and public postsecondary institutions shall offer support and technical assistance to
schools and school districts in the development of accelerated learning.
A student who participates in accelerated learning under this section shall be
permitted to take the college admissions examination a second time prior to high
school graduation at the expense of the Kentucky Department of Education. The
cost of any subsequent administrations of the achievement test shall be the
responsibility of the student.
Effective: July 15, 2016
History: Amended 2016 Ky. Acts ch. 136, sec. 7, effective July 15, 2016. -- Amended
2009 Ky. Acts ch. 101, sec. 6, effective March 25, 2009. -- Created 2006 Ky. Acts
ch. 227, sec. 2, effective July 12, 2006.
